Transaction 313426609121d57173948331511b0ea04298a07cd50c384dcb1e61b2b53da359
1 Input
1 Output
-
313426609121d57173948331511b0ea04298a07cd50c384dcb1e61b2b53da359: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8539e495df32b9274652162341bf4a7728c2d2a2231510b1d3caed66b52158aa
- address
- bc1ps5u7f9wlx2ujw3jjzc35r062wu5v954zyv23pvwnetkkddfptz4qvq7xy5